AutoscalerAutoscalingPolicyAr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"bjcsoouounlfhriw")
suspend fun cooldownPeriod(value: Output<Int>)
@JvmName(name = "kfljwtgcsvdjgxcu")
suspend fun cooldownPeriod(value: Int?)
Link copied to clipboard
@JvmName(name = "eybfduopjqwoqbdg")
suspend fun cpuUtilization(value: Output<AutoscalerAutoscalingPolicyCpuUtilizationArgs>)
@JvmName(name = "vtijdjfwgxmuapre")
suspend fun cpuUtilization(value: AutoscalerAutoscalingPolicyCpuUtilizationArgs?)
@JvmName(name = "myhkqggjylrqqnks")
suspend fun cpuUtilization(argument: suspend AutoscalerAutoscalingPolicyCpuUtilizationArgsBuilder.() -> Unit)
Link copied to clipboard
Link copied to clipboard
@JvmName(name = "cuoedsjwfjfpkkch")
suspend fun maxReplicas(value: Output<Int>)
@JvmName(name = "gmcbiipwqnbfidaa")
suspend fun maxReplicas(value: Int)
Link copied to clipboard
@JvmName(name = "vbigdwkdbvfjnutu")
suspend fun metrics(value: Output<List<AutoscalerAutoscalingPolicyMetricArgs>>)
@JvmName(name = "oobqrggnvuwybpgr")
suspend fun metrics(vararg values: Output<AutoscalerAutoscalingPolicyMetricArgs>)
@JvmName(name = "kkymftdvsbvokbfp")
suspend fun metrics(vararg values: AutoscalerAutoscalingPolicyMetricArgs)
@JvmName(name = "opgfukbekhdeukgh")
suspend fun metrics(vararg argument: suspend AutoscalerAutoscalingPolicyMetricArgsBuilder.() -> Unit)
@JvmName(name = "yiecpbpgxnangrtg")
suspend fun metrics(values: List<Output<AutoscalerAutoscalingPolicyMetricArgs>>)
@JvmName(name = "ruqskfhwrkmlfuat")
suspend fun metrics(value: List<AutoscalerAutoscalingPolicyMetricArgs>?)
@JvmName(name = "etvxcodumqiipyvu")
suspend fun metrics(argument: List<suspend AutoscalerAutoscalingPolicyMetricArgsBuilder.() -> Unit>)
@JvmName(name = "ohxoyjyqthjbbach")
suspend fun metrics(argument: suspend AutoscalerAutoscalingPolicyMetricAr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"plvnumeqobbskfdk")
suspend fun minReplicas(value: Output<Int>)
@JvmName(name = "ckjhxvkkyjkyhmbg")
suspend fun minReplicas(value: Int)
Link copied to clipboard
@JvmName(name = "ixcddftlbdokevti")
suspend fun mode(value: Output<String>)
@JvmName(name = "podrfwwajfgcenhc")
suspend fun mode(value: String?)
Link copied to clipboard
@JvmName(name = "xsaqlmnuasjnvssh")
suspend fun scaleDownControl(value: Output<AutoscalerAutoscalingPolicyScaleDownControlArgs>)
@JvmName(name = "gddwaxjrxxmtsepn")
suspend fun scaleDownControl(value: AutoscalerAutoscalingPolicyScaleDownControlArgs?)
@JvmName(name = "llgsmpkjoeooicsx")
suspend fun scaleDownControl(argument: suspend AutoscalerAutoscalingPolicyScaleDownControlAr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"yunlodopjgbcoemq")
suspend fun scaleInControl(value: Output<AutoscalerAutoscalingPolicyScaleInControlArgs>)
@JvmName(name = "pgwtgxmqaxamecwb")
suspend fun scaleInControl(value: AutoscalerAutoscalingPolicyScaleInControlArgs?)
@JvmName(name = "eraavadbfmdhrabh")
suspend fun scaleInControl(argument: suspend AutoscalerAutoscalingPolicyScaleInControlAr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ignfvbktmstgikoy")
suspend fun scalingSchedules(value: Output<List<AutoscalerAutoscalingPolicyScalingScheduleArgs>>)
@JvmName(name = "aactwbsccmqmbuae")
suspend fun scalingSchedules(vararg values: Output<AutoscalerAutoscalingPolicyScalingScheduleArgs>)
@JvmName(name = "dtjjofvewewgdmhs")
suspend fun scalingSchedules(vararg values: AutoscalerAutoscalingPolicyScalingScheduleArgs)
@JvmName(name = "dewnpfbnfpututym")
suspend fun scalingSchedules(vararg argument: suspend AutoscalerAutoscalingPolicyScalingScheduleArgsBuilder.() -> Unit)
@JvmName(name = "pnfrxosnhyniehen")
suspend fun scalingSchedules(values: List<Output<AutoscalerAutoscalingPolicyScalingScheduleArgs>>)
@JvmName(name = "apttqmvkpngigjyq")
suspend fun scalingSchedules(value: List<AutoscalerAutoscalingPolicyScalingScheduleArgs>?)
@JvmName(name = "xpjdhlumtdnxwewd")
suspend fun scalingSchedules(argument: List<suspend AutoscalerAutoscalingPolicyScalingScheduleArgsBuilder.() -> Unit>)
@JvmName(name = "gjbdpnwrrkmiehge")
suspend fun scalingSchedules(argument: suspend AutoscalerAutoscalingPolicyScalingScheduleArgsBuilder.() -> Unit)